#1e572d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1e572d is composed of 11.8% red, 34.1% green and 17.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 65.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 48.3% yellow and 65.9% black. It has a hue angle of 135.8 degrees, a saturation of 48.7% and a lightness of 22.9%. #1e572d color hex could be obtained by blending #3cae5a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

Shades and Tints of #1e572d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050e07 is the darkest color, while #feff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1e572d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#393c3a is the less saturated color, while #037220 is the most saturated one.
